Satellite map of Shanghai South Railway Station (Metro)

Map of Shanghai South Railway Station (Metro)

Shanghai South Railway Station Station (Chinese: 上海南站站; pinyin: Shànghǎi Nánzhàn Zhàn) is the name of an interchange station between Lines 1 and 3 of the Shanghai Metro.

Latitude: 31° 09' 19.08" N
Longitude: 121° 25' 33.60" E

Read about Shanghai South Railway Station (Metro) in the Wikipedia Satellite map of Shanghai South Railway Station (Metro) in Google Maps

GPS coordinates of Shanghai South Railway Station (Metro), China

Download as JSON